According to recent reports the former heavyweight champion of the world made a visit to Portland Oregon last week to meet with executives from the Jordan Brand.
Over the last several years the premier Jordan Brand has been working hard at gaining market share within the boxing apparel and gear industry signing boxers Roy Jones Jr. and Andre Ward to the list of high profile athletes under the Jordan brand.
A talk of the former heavyweight champion of the world joining the Jordan brand has certainly caught attention from the sport of boxing with positive feedback. I mean when you think of boxing is there a bigger name than Mike Tyson? Adding a high profile boxing legend like Mike Tyson to mix could be exactly what the Jordan Brand needs to gain market share and attention as a leader in the sport of boxing.
While there is no doubt that Tyson has led a life of controversy outside, and even inside the ring, the former heavyweight champion has addressed his life struggles with drugs and alcohol and is now living a clean and sober life with his wife Kiki and two children in Las Vegas. Tyson stars in his “one man show” The Undisputed Truth which has had amazing success featuring him alone on stage telling the struggles and triumphs of his life. The show is reportedly getting ready for an international tour starting in late 2013 and early 2014. He also has a show airing on Fox Sports 1 titled: Being Mike Tyson which has captured a large following.
The success in the documentation of his life speaks to the amazing following the former heavyweight champ still carries, even beyond the sport of boxing. While details on the deal are still unclear, one thing is for sure, Mike Tyson would be an invaluable asset to the Jordan Brand and a strategic partnership for both.
Fanscreens an online marketing agency based out of Florida is said to be spearheading the deal between the two parties.
